Another good way to spend the afternoon is with Jose Gonzalez. He hasn't done any solo stuff for a while now, since he's been focused on putting out albums with his band Junip. I do enjoy Junip as well, but I much prefer his solo stuff. And now he's got a new album coming out this year, Vestiges & Claws, which I'm very excited about. He put out the first single, Every Age, late last year. And before that, he put out another track, This Is How We Walk On The Moon, which was part of the Red Hot + Arthur Russel, a compilation which also included a new track from Sufjan Stevens who also has a new album coming out later this year. Sadly, This Is How We Walk On The Moon won't be on his new album, but it's a great song, it made it into my playlist for best tracks of 2014, so enjoy.
